Your role
The TIS Board is responsible for providing leadership, monitoring performance, agreeing on the strategic direction of the organisation, and ensuring its long-term success. Meetings are held 8-weekly, and Board Directors will also be required to attend additional Committee meetings, a strategic planning day, full induction, and ongoing training opportunities.
There are a variety of benefits that you can gain from becoming a TIS Board Director including working with new and interesting people, taking part in new challenges, and gaining experience to assist your personal and career development.
